Description


SUMMARY
A superb 'A' Rated single-storey home positioned within a small, exclusive development, offers three generously sized bedrooms, two well-appointed bathrooms, and a bespoke fully fitted kitchen with high-quality appliances. Featuring a beautifully landscaped front garden, ample parking, and garage.


DESCRIPTION
Show Home Available to View
This latest project, The Willows, by WSB Developments offers a mix of luxury 3 & 4 Bedroom single-storey homes built and finished with exacting attention to detail. Each property will have an 'A' Rated energy performance, air source under floor heating with smart touch controls, solar panels and preparation for an EV charging point preparation. Additionally, each home will feature a bespoke fitted kitchen, with quartz worktops as standard, Bosch appliances to include induction hob, oven, dishwasher and fridge/freezer and Porcelanosa tiling. Externally, front gardens will be landscaped, and each property will have a block paved driveway and garaging providing every convenience in a beautiful private setting. Designed to maximize the advantages of a south-west facing garden, these homes provide their owners with the comfort of an exceptional living space.

Location 
The Village of Bedfield is set in beautiful countryside between the towns of Framlingham and Debenham. The village has a Church, Primary School, brand new children's play area, sports field, tennis court and a Community Club. The well-known market town of Framlingham is located less than 5 miles away and features a twelfth-century castle and church, the Market Hill, excellent variety of independent shops, supermarket, public houses and restaurants. It is also the site of a twice-weekly market selling fresh fish, bread, fruit and vegetables. There are several Outstanding schools in the proximity, namely independent Framlingham College, the award-winning state secondary school Thomas Mills and a primary school. For commuters, the main railway station at nearby Diss provides direct services to London's Liverpool Street Station in just over an hour, as well as connections to Ipswich and Norwich. The charming coastal towns of Southwold, Aldeburgh and Thorpeness are also within the immediate vicinity.
